Edward Benton McGahan

Portsmouth-Edward Benton McGahan, 70, of Portsmouth, passed away Wednesday, June 27, 2018 at SOMC ER in Portsmouth. Edward was born October 29, 1947 in Wheelersburg to the late Leondias Kermit and Ebbie Francis Wesley McGahan. Edward was employed in maintenance at Dayton Gary Iron; he was of the Christian faith and he was a U.S. Marine serving during the Vietnam War. In addition to his parents he was preceded in death by his wife, Wanda Sue Smith McGahan whom he married November 4, 1970 at South Shore, KY. Also preceding him in death were three brothers, Jack, Hoy and Ken and three sisters, Anna McGahan, Shirley Guiterrez and Alfreda Jean Bright. Edward is survived by a son, Edward Benton (Charity) McGahan, II; four daughters, Betty McGahan, Sara Lynn McGahan, Brenda Jay Robinson and Edwin Beverly McGahan; two brothers, “Ike” Dwight Glen McGahan and Allen McGahan; a sister, Suzie Sweeney; seventeen grandchildren and twenty-seven great grandchildren.

Funeral services will be 11:00 am Saturday, June 30, 2018 at Harrison-Pyles Funeral Home in Wheelersburg with Pastor Ronnie Blevins officiating. Interment will follow in Sunset Memorial Gardens where military rites will be conducted by American Legion James Dickey Post #23. The family will receive friends at the funeral home 6:00-8:00 pm Friday, June 29, 2018 and one hour before the service on Saturday.
